How do you strip a cord?

To strip a fabric-covered cord, you’ll need some tape, a pair of scissors, and, optionally, a pair of electrician’s pliers.

  1. Cut a piece of adhesive tape and wrap it around the fabric cable you want to strip, about two centimeters from the end. This way, when you strip the cord, its fabric won't unravel completely.
  2. With scissors, cut the cord near the adhesive tape. Be careful to cut only the fabric and the plastic sheath, not the electrical wire inside. Now, the electrical wire should be exposed. Slide off the fabric and plastic sheath to reveal the electrical wire.
  3. Finally, to remove the plastic coating from the electrical wire and expose the metal strands, you can use electrician's pliers to cut the coating. Alternatively, using scissors, you can apply some pressure to the coating. By doing so, you should now be able to slide it off and expose the metal strands.
